LPTIM registers
26.7.1
LPTIM interrupt and status register (LPTIM_ISR)
Address offset: 0x000
Reset value: 0x0000 0000

Bits 31:9 Reserved, must be kept at reset value.
Bit 8 REPOK: Repetition register update Ok
REPOK is set by hardware to inform application that the APB bus write operation to the LPTIM_RCR
register has been successfully completed. REPOK flag can be cleared by writing 1 to the REPOKCF
bit in the LPTIM_ICR register.
Bit 7 UE: LPTIM update event occurred
UE is set by hardware to inform application that an update event was generated. UE flag can be
cleared by writing 1 to the UECF bit in the LPTIM_ICR register.
Bit 6 DOWN: Counter direction change up to down
In Encoder mode, DOWN bit is set by hardware to inform application that the counter direction has
changed from up to down. DOWN flag can be cleared by writing 1 to the DOWNCF bit in the
LPTIM_ICR register.

Bit 5 UP: Counter direction change down to up
In Encoder mode, UP bit is set by hardware to inform application that the counter direction has
changed from down to up. UP flag can be cleared by writing 1 to the UPCF bit in the LPTIM_ICR
register.

Bit 4 ARROK: Autoreload register update OK
ARROK is set by hardware to inform application that the APB bus write operation to the LPTIM_ARR
register has been successfully completed. ARROK flag can be cleared by writing 1 to the ARROKCF
bit in the LPTIM_ICR register.
